The Defense Logistics Agency-Aberdeen, on behalf of the Army Integrated Logistics Supply Center (ILSC) is conducting market research to support long-term sustainment of the APX-123A transponder system. The government believes BAE Systems is the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) and sole source for these specific National Item Identification Numbers (NIINs) listed below; however, interested parties who believe they possess these capabilities are invited to submit a capability statement within 15 days. We request that sources who can manufacture the listed parts or services submit information to show their capability to manufacture the same part. At a minimum the support information you submit should include, but is not limited to, the following types of documentation: questionnaire, drawings, test results, information on previous Government and commercial contracts, data rights, etc. In your response, please include your company name, CAGE code, and a technical point of contact with email address and telephone number. Items and/or Services to Be Procured: • NIIN 01-560-2880 - Power Supply • NIIN 01-877-8778 - Modification Kit, Mode 4 • NIIN 01-631-9249 - Single Board Computer • NIIN 01-333-3333 - Signal Processor • NIIN 01-643-0548 - Mode 5 Crypto Card • NIIN 01-503-7423 - RF Module This request is issued solely for information and planning purposes - it does not constitute a solicitation or a promise to issue in solicitation in the future.
